Sudo is best implemented by giving users specific access to certain commands
rather than giving ALL access and then attempting to take away the ones you
don't want them to have.

Subject: ./sudo vi
Is there a way to prevent an unauthorized user gaining access to root by
using the vi command?
For example
./sudo vi /tmp/tst
Once vi opens test
!/bin/ksh
